I am in a position to get our software company certified in AS9100 (first time) which has been self-contained in the states with all departments reporting to a local General Manager. Other portions of the company are located in Europe (mainly CEO etc.) which have little input/impact on the way our work is performed. I had been planning for a site specific certification given the process already in place.

But an upcoming re-org will have Product Management, Program Management, Production Operation, etc departments reporting to Management in Europe. (Development/Test remain to report to local Management. With that does the scope of the certification move from a site specific to include the new re-org? Any info would be appreciated as to re-schedule upcoming audit.

Since exclusions are limited to section 7 and your management is in Europe, separate certifications will most likely not be an option.

If I understand correctly, my thoughts are that you will have one certification specifying both the US and European locations (I am assuming there are only two?). It does not sound like you can certify the US location without including the European location, if that is where the management of the organization is based. I am basing my opinion on a comparison with my own organization where we have a central location with two satellite D&D offices.
